noun, noun or participle which takes 'suru', transitive verb, noun which may take the genitive case particle 'no'
dedication ; offering ; presentation
Refers to the act of formally dedicating or presenting something to a deity, shrine, or temple. Often used in religious or ceremonial contexts. The gloss 'oblation' is a more specialized religious term.

Kanji 奉 observance, offer, present 納 settlement, obtain, reap Similar words 寄き 進しん 寄進 refers specifically to donating land, buildings, or money to a temple or shrine, while 奉納 is broader and includes offerings of performances, objects, or other items.
献けん 納のう 献納 is a more general term for offering or presenting something to a superior or institution, not necessarily religious.
Etymology Compound of 奉 (ほう, 'to offer respectfully') and 納 (のう, 'to dedicate, pay'). The kanji combination directly reflects the meaning of presenting something with reverence.
